Golf course was in great shape! The staff was friendly and helpful. The course is very complex, simple and open in some places but very tight and unforgiving in others. I really enjoyed the challenge and was relieved to see the relaxed holes. The practice area is top notch with driving range, putting and chipping areas. I have absolutely no complaints about this course. I will definitely play here again and I will talk about this course often. Thanks again for a wonderful experience.
